In recent decades, authors affiliated with Southeast Missouri State University have published 1.9k papers, which have received a total of 29.1k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 170 papers in Education, 164 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 140 papers in Social Psychology on the topics of Efficiency Analysis Using DEA (53 papers), Amphibian and Reptile Biology (42 papers) and Plant and animal studies (38 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Economics and Econometrics (3.7k citations), Sociology and Political Science (3.2k citations) and Management Science and Operations Research (3.0k citations). Authors at Southeast Missouri State University collaborate with scholars in United States, China and Japan and have published in prestigious journals including Nature, Journal of the American Chemical Society and The Journal of Chemical Physics. Some of Southeast Missouri State University's most productive authors include William Weber, Sean B. Eom, William E. Snell, Hirofumi Fukuyama and Thomas J. Pujol.
